On-Vehicle Repair

CAUTION: When working with FIPG material, you must observe the following items.
  • Using a razor blade and gasket scraper, remove all the old FIPG material from the gasket surfaces. 
  • Thoroughly clean all components to remove all the loose material. 
  • Clean both sealing surfaces with a non-residue solvent. 
  • Apply FIPG in an approx. 1 mm (0.04 in.) wide bead along the sealing surface. 
  • Parts must be assembled within 10 minutes of application. Otherwise, the FIPG material must be removed and reapplied. 
  1. REMOVE DRAIN PLUG WITH GASKET AND DRAIN ATF 
  2. REMOVE OIL PAN 
    NOTE: Some fluid will remain in the oil pan.
    1. Remove the 19 bolts.
      Fig 1: Identifying Oil Pan Bolts
      G02943212Courtesy of © TOYOTA, LICENSE AGREEMENT TMS1002
    2. Install the blade of SST between the transmission case and oil pan, cut off applied sealer, and remove the oil pan.

      SST 09032-00100

      NOTE: When removing the oil pan, be careful not to damage the oil pan flange.
      Fig 2: Removing Oil Pan
      G02943213Courtesy of © TOYOTA, LICENSE AGREEMENT TMS1002
  3. EXAMINE PARTICLES IN PAN 

    Remove the magnets and use them to collect steel particles. Carefully look at the foreign matter and particles in the pan and on the magnets to anticipate the type of wear you will find in the transmission.

    Steel (magnetic) ... bearing, gear and clutch plate wear Brass (non-magnetic) ... bushing wear

    Fig 3: Examining Particles In Pan
    G02943214Courtesy of © TOYOTA, LICENSE AGREEMENT TMS1002
  4. REMOVE OIL STRAINER 
    NOTE: Be careful as some fluid will come out of the oil strainer.
    1. Remove the 4 bolts and oil strainer.
      Fig 4: Removing Oil Strainer
      G02943215Courtesy of © TOYOTA, LICENSE AGREEMENT TMS1002
    2. Remove the 3 gaskets from the oil strainer.
      Fig 5: Removing 3 Gaskets From Oil Strainer
      G02943216Courtesy of © TOYOTA, LICENSE AGREEMENT TMS1002
  5. REMOVE SOLENOID WIRING WITH ATF TEMPERATURE SENSOR 
    1. Disconnect the ATF temperature sensor.
    2. Remove the bolt and clamp.
    3. Disconnect the 7 connectors from the solenoid valves.
      Fig 6: Removing Solenoid Wiring
      G02943217Courtesy of © TOYOTA, LICENSE AGREEMENT TMS1002
    4. Remove the bolt and pull out the solenoid connector.
  6. INSTALL SOLENOID WIRING WITH ATF TEMPERATURE SENSOR 
    1. Install the solenoid connector with the bolt.

      Torque: 5.4 N.m (55 kgf.cm, 48 in.lbf) 

      Fig 7: Installing Solenoid Connector
      G02943218Courtesy of © TOYOTA, LICENSE AGREEMENT TMS1002
    2. Connect the 7 connectors to the solenoid valves.
    3. Install the clamp with the bolt.

      Torque: 6.4 N.m (65 kgf.cm, 56 in.lbf) 

    4. Connect the ATF temperature sensor.
      Fig 8: Installing Solenoid Wiring
      G02943219Courtesy of © TOYOTA, LICENSE AGREEMENT TMS1002
  7. INSTALL OIL STRAINER 
    1. Install 3 new gaskets.
      Fig 9: Installing New Gaskets
      G02943220Courtesy of © TOYOTA, LICENSE AGREEMENT TMS1002
    2. Install the oil strainer with the 4 bolts.

      Torque: 9.8 N.m (100 kgf.cm, 7 ft.lbf) 

      Fig 10: Installing Oil Strainer
      G02943221Courtesy of © TOYOTA, LICENSE AGREEMENT TMS1002
  8. INSTALL OIL PAN 
    1. Install the 3 magnets in the indications of the oil pan.
      Fig 11: Identifying Positions For Installing Magnets
      G02943222Courtesy of © TOYOTA, LICENSE AGREEMENT TMS1002
    2. Remove any packing material and be careful not to drop oil on the contacting surfaces of the transmission case and oil pan.
    3. Apply FIPG to the oil pan.

      FIPG: 

      Fig 12: Measuring Seal Bead
      G02943223Courtesy of © TOYOTA, LICENSE AGREEMENT TMS1002

      Part No. 08826 - 00090, THREE BOND 1281 or equivalent 

      Fig 13: Installing Oil Pan
      G02943224Courtesy of © TOYOTA, LICENSE AGREEMENT TMS1002
    4. Install the oil pan with the 19 bolts.

      Torque: 7.4 N.m (75 kgf.cm, 65 in.lbf) 

      HINT:

      Replace the only "A" bolt with a new one.

  9. INSTALL DRAIN PLUG WITH NEW GASKET 

    Torque: 20 N.m (205 kgf.cm, 15 ft.lbf) 

  10. FILL FLUID AND CHECK FLUID
